USB camera detection problem

hello,help,help!!!
使用摄像头进行目标检测时总是出错!!!
摄像头在dev下显示为video1

1. sudo -i 
2. git clone https://gitlab.com/khadas/aml_npu_demo_binaries
3. cd aml_npu_demo_binaries/detect_demo
4. ./INSTALL
5. ./detect_demo_uvc /dev/video0 1

我按照上面的步骤执行,在执行 ./detect_demo_uvc /dev/video0 1时总会报错,如图:


希望知道如何解决的朋友或官方人员能给出宝贵的解决问题的方法,感谢

@penggeng 确定/dev/video1是节点么

确定,每次插拔摄像头,ls dev,video1都会随着插拔出现和消失

@penggeng 我看图片上/dev/video1 前面有.这个点加了肯定不对的.然后你是使用什么USB摄像头,我们这边测试用的是罗技的,你的摄像头是免驱动的摄像头么

@Frank .是误打的,我刚测试了一下,发现去掉后情况一样。我使用的是Logitech HD Webcam C310摄像头。 我看了论坛里一些问题,发现我遇到的问题和这个题主提出的一样Having trouble running NPU Demo

@penggeng 你用cheese能打开这个摄像头么,

@Frank 我在我的主机上使用cheese能打开的

@penggeng 你要在板子上试,平台不一样

@Frank 我尝试在板子上安装cheese(sudo apt-get install cheese),发现会出现如下问题,我尝试解决,无果,您看看

@penggeng 桌面版本工具里有一个摄像头工具.你可以在开始菜单找到

@Frank 我插拔摄像头,此工具都没有反应,卡在如图情况

:sob:

@penggeng 分辨率选择1920x1080,强制关闭软件或者重启吧

@Frank 我又试了一下,摄像头能正常打开。目前使用的Logitech HD Webcam C310不支持1920x1080,视频检测必须要1920x1080吗?

@penggeng 你可以修改源码,支持你的分辨率

@Frank 您能详细一点吗,修改哪些文件以及哪些地方需要修改

@penggeng https://gitlab.com/khadas/aml_npu_app/-/blob/master/detect_library/yoloface_demo_gst_uvc/main.cpp

这里面有关于显示的设置,你可以看一下,文件不是很复杂.另外你需要了解一下这个仓库如果生成可执行文件